Server: Win2000, IIS 5.0, latest service packs

Just downloaded the latest LICENSED version of UBBclassic.

I've installed & reinstalled half a dozen times. When I run cp.cgi, I am able to set all the paths. ubbclassic_test.cgi reports everything being okay.

When I go to add the admin user, I get this:
HTTP 403.1 Forbidden: Execute Access Forbidden

I have the permissions to UBB and GBI-BIN wide open. Still, periodically files get created with wrong permissions (list access only). I manually reset them to "777," but to no avail.

It almost seems like your cgi-bin doesn't have execute permissions from IIS

You have attempted to execute a CGI, ISAPI, or other executable program from a directory that does not allow programs to be executed.

Not to mention when I tried to register on your boards, It hops me to http://65.169.188.92/cgi-bin/ultimatebb.cgi?ubb=agree instead of driveradvocate.com.

I would fix your paths so that they all use the domain name. If you continue to get the 403.1, make sure your cgi-bin directory has execute permissions.

Did you change File or directory permissions?

My cgi-bin directory permissions are set to 755, All files in cgi-bin are 755 except vars_*.cgi which should be 777.
